Collectors Universe Facts
- Collectors Universe Website: Official Website
- Year Collectors Universe was Founded: 1986
- Collectors Universe Headquarters: Santa Ana, CA
- Collectors Universe Founder(s): Joseph Orlando
- Current Collectors Universe Chief Executive: Joseph Orlando
- Collectors Universe Subsidiaries / Brands: PCGS, PSA, Set Registry, CCE, Long Beach Expo
What is Collectors Universe?
Collectors Universe, Inc. is the leader in third-party grading and authentication services for high-value collectibles. The Collectors Universe brands are among the strongest and best known in their respective markets. We authenticate and grade collectible coins, trading cards, tickets, autographs and memorabilia. We also compile and publish authoritative information about United States and World coins, collectible trading cards and memorabilia. Grading and Authentication Services – Coins, trading cards, autographs and memorabilia comprise our principal authentication and grading markets. Our brands in those markets include: Professional Coin Grading Service (PCGS), the world’s leading third-party coin grading service; Professional Sports Authenticator (PSA); the world’s leading third-party trading card grading service; and PSA/DNA Authentication Services (PSA/DNA), the largest and most respected autograph authentication provider. Collectors Universe Revenue Totals
Collectors Universe annual revenue:
- 2019: $72 million
- 2018: $68 million
- 2017: $70 million
- 2016: $60 million
- 2015: $61 million
Collectors Universe annual net income:
- 2019: $9.9 million
- 2018: $6.2 million
- 2017: $8.5 million
- 2016: $7.6 million
- 2015: $7.4 million
